20.4.1. Authorized discharge<br />

When a nuclear power plant is licensed, the application usually <strong>in</strong>cludes also the permit<br />

of authorized discharges of gaseous and liquid effluents. For discharge authorization, the<br />

follow<strong>in</strong>g po<strong>in</strong>ts have to be demonstrated:<br />

The generation of waste <strong>in</strong> terms of activity and volume is kept to the m<strong>in</strong>imum<br />

practicable; and<br />

All available options for waste disposal are taken <strong>in</strong>to account to ensure that the<br />

discharge to the environment is an acceptable option.<br />

The application should <strong>in</strong>clude the follow<strong>in</strong>g <strong>in</strong>formation:<br />

The characteristics and activity of the material to be discharged and the potential<br />

po<strong>in</strong>ts and methods of discharge;<br />

All significant exposure pathways by which discharged nuclides can cause public<br />

exposure; and<br />

The expected critical group doses due to the planned discharges.<br />

Sett<strong>in</strong>g the dose constra<strong>in</strong>ts<br />

The general annual radiation dose limit for the members of the public is 1 mSv. Due to<br />

allowances made for future unknown practices, and exempted sources etc., the dose<br />

constra<strong>in</strong>t from any particular practice has to be well below 1 mSv. In different countries,<br />

the dose constra<strong>in</strong>ts for the most exposed population groups (critical groups) applied for<br />

nuclear fuel facilities usually vary between 0.1 mSv/a and 0.3 mSv/a, nuclear power<br />

plants represent<strong>in</strong>g the lower end.<br />
